Having recently rejoined the Conservative Party after 21 years, the Iraq Britain Business Council’s President Baroness Nicholson of Winterbourne attended the annual Conservative Party Conference in Birmingham from Sunday 2 October to Tuesday 4 October 2016. She was joined by Christophe Michels, IBBC’s Managing Director.

At the conference Baroness Nicholson met Prime Minister Theresa May, Foreign Secretary Boris Johnson, Secretary of State for International Trade Dr Liam Fox, and Minister of State of the Department for International Development Rory Stuart. She also participated in various panel discussions, including one that explored the possible consequences of Brexit for the financial service sector. Among those who joined Baroness Nicholson on the panel were the chief executives of the London Stock Exchange and TheCityUK.
